Do I Need a Timeshare Cancellation Attorney to Get Out of My Timeshare?

Short answer: not always. 

Long answer: if you are serious about getting out, and you still owe money or are facing collection pressure, you probably need a timeshare cancellation attorney who can legally step in and deal with the company for you.

A lot of people try to handle this on their own first. That makes sense. You’re smart. You can read. You can make phone calls. You don’t want to spend more money on a problem you already regret.

The question isn’t whether you’re capable. The question is whether the timeshare company has any reason to deal fairly with you.

What Happens When You Try to Cancel a Timeshare Yourself?

Here’s what typically happens:

  1. You call.
  2. They transfer you.
  3. You explain your situation.
  4. They tell you there’s no cancellation option.
  5. Or they offer to “help” by selling you more points.
  6. Or they say you can surrender it… if you pay thousands first.

If you stop paying, the tone changes. You may start getting collection calls. Letters. Threats about your credit.

This is common with major developers like Marriott, Wyndham, Hilton, Hyatt, and Bluegreen. These are large, sophisticated companies. Their contracts are written to protect them, not you.

At that point, it’s no longer a customer service issue. It’s a legal and financial issue.

When to Hire a Timeshare Lawyer or Timeshare Cancellation Attorney

You may want to speak with a timeshare lawyer if:

  • You still owe money on your timeshare loan.
  • Maintenance fees keep increasing.
  • The company says there is “no way out.”
  • You’ve already tried and gotten nowhere.
  • A collection agency is contacting you.
  • You’re concerned about your credit.

This is especially true if the numbers are significant.

If you owe $20,000, $40,000, or more to a company like Marriott Vacation Club or Wyndham, this is not a small problem. It is long-term financial exposure.

That’s when hiring a timeshare cancellation attorney starts to make sense.

Why Not Just Use a Timeshare Exit Company?

You’ve seen the ads. Here’s the reality: non-lawyers cannot legally represent you in negotiating a contract. Many timeshare exit companies collect large upfront fees and either hand you off to a lawyer anyway or provide you with template letters they expect you to send.

If a timeshare attorney is ultimately needed, it makes more sense to hire one directly. Cut out the middleman.

What a Timeshare Cancellation Attorney Actually Does

At Connor Law, PC, the process is direct.

  1. You hire the firm.
  2. Your contract and facts are reviewed.
  3. Demand letters are sent.
  4. Negotiations begin.
  5. Pressure is applied when necessary.

Most timeshare cancellation cases do not go to court. The goal is resolution, not drama.

And once a company like Hilton Grand Vacations, Hyatt Vacation Club, or Bluegreen knows you are represented by a lawyer, direct collection contact typically has to stop. That changes the dynamic immediately.

Is Hiring a Timeshare Attorney Worth It?

That depends on the math. If you owe tens of thousands on a timeshare mortgage and face annual maintenance fees that never go away, doing nothing is expensive.

If you pay a flat fee to a timeshare cancellation attorney and eliminate that ongoing liability, the numbers often speak for themselves.
